Course Content

• Data Analysis for Supply Chain Optimization
• Predictive Modeling in Supply Chain Management
• Forecasting and Demand Planning using Data Analytics
• Inventory Management and Optimization through Data Interpretation
• Supply Chain Risk Management using Data-Driven Insights
• Business Intelligence and Data Visualization for Supply Chain
• Data Mining Techniques for Supply Chain Efficiency
• Advanced Statistical Methods for Supply Chain Data Analysis

Career path

Career Role (Supply Chain Analyst) Description
Supply Chain Data Analyst Leveraging data interpretation skills to optimize logistics, inventory, and procurement processes. Key skills include SQL, data visualization, and forecasting.
Demand Planning Specialist Forecasting future demand using advanced analytical techniques. Crucial for inventory management and supply chain efficiency, requiring strong data analysis capabilities.
Supply Chain Optimization Manager Utilizing data-driven insights to streamline supply chain operations, reducing costs, improving efficiency, and enhancing customer satisfaction. Requires expertise in data interpretation and supply chain management principles.
Procurement Data Analyst Analyzing procurement data to identify cost savings, negotiate better contracts, and optimize supplier relationships. Skills in data mining, analytics, and procurement strategies are essential.
